FAQs on HBL Engineering Ltd. Shareprice

HBL Engineering has given better returns compared to its competitors.
HBL Engineering has grown at ~32.49% over the last 10yrs while peers have grown at a median rate of 2.3%

Yes, HBL Engineering is expensive.
Latest PE of HBL Engineering is 62.48, while 3 year average PE is 50.1.
Also latest EV/EBITDA of HBL Engineering is 44.69 while 3yr average is 26.4.

FAQs on HBL Engineering Ltd. Financials

Balance sheet of HBL Engineering is strong.
It shouldn't have solvency or liquidity issues.

Yes, The debt of HBL Engineering is increasing.
Latest debt of HBL Engineering is -₹87.86 Crs as of Mar-25.
This is greater than Mar-24 when it was -₹410.47 Crs.

Yes, profit is increasing.
The profit of HBL Engineering is ₹328 Crs for TTM, ₹281 Crs for Mar 2024 and ₹98.65 Crs for Mar 2023.

The company seems to be paying a very low dividend.
Investors need to see where the company is allocating its profits.
HBL Engineering latest dividend payout ratio is 4.93% and 3yr average dividend payout ratio is 9.8%
